Package org.hl7.v3

Class IVLINT


public class IVLINT extends SXCMINT

Java class for IVL_INT complex type.

The following schema fragment specifies the expected content contained within this class.

 <complexType name="IVL_INT">
   <complexContent>
     <extension base="{urn:hl7-org:v3}SXCM_INT">
       <choice minOccurs="0">
         <sequence>
           <element name="low" type="{urn:hl7-org:v3}IVXB_INT"/>
           <choice minOccurs="0">
             <element name="width" type="{urn:hl7-org:v3}INT" minOccurs="0"/>
             <element name="high" type="{urn:hl7-org:v3}IVXB_INT" minOccurs="0"/>
           </choice>
         </sequence>
         <element name="high" type="{urn:hl7-org:v3}IVXB_INT"/>
         <sequence>
           <element name="width" type="{urn:hl7-org:v3}INT"/>
           <element name="high" type="{urn:hl7-org:v3}IVXB_INT" minOccurs="0"/>
         </sequence>
         <sequence>
           <element name="center" type="{urn:hl7-org:v3}INT"/>
           <element name="width" type="{urn:hl7-org:v3}INT" minOccurs="0"/>
         </sequence>
       </choice>
     </extension>
   </complexContent>
 </complexType>
 
  • Field Details

    • rest

      protected List<jakarta.xml.bind.JAXBElement<? extends INT>> rest
  • Constructor Details

    • IVLINT

      public IVLINT()
  • Method Details

    • getRest

      public List<jakarta.xml.bind.JAXBElement<? extends INT>> getRest()
      Gets the rest of the content model.

      You are getting this "catch-all" property because of the following reason: The field name "High" is used by two different parts of a schema. See: line 798 of file:/home/jenkins/agent/workspace/OpenNCP-ncpeh_simulation_api-maven_central_release/ncpeh-simulation-ehdsi-model/src/main/resources/schemas/HL7V3/NE2008/coreschemas/datatypes.xsd line 789 of file:/home/jenkins/agent/workspace/OpenNCP-ncpeh_simulation_api-maven_central_release/ncpeh-simulation-ehdsi-model/src/main/resources/schemas/HL7V3/NE2008/coreschemas/datatypes.xsd

      To get rid of this property, apply a property customization to one of both of the following declarations to change their names: Gets the value of the rest property.

      This accessor method returns a reference to the live list, not a snapshot. Therefore any modification you make to the returned list will be present inside the Jakarta XML Binding object. This is why there is not a set method for the rest property.

      For example, to add a new item, do as follows:

          getRest().add(newItem);
       

      Objects of the following type(s) are allowed in the list JAXBElement<INT> JAXBElement<INT> JAXBElement<IVXBINT> JAXBElement<IVXBINT>

    • withRest

      public IVLINT withRest(jakarta.xml.bind.JAXBElement<? extends INT>... values)
    • withRest

      public IVLINT withRest(Collection<jakarta.xml.bind.JAXBElement<? extends INT>> values)
    • withOperator

      public IVLINT withOperator(SetOperator value)
      Overrides:
      withOperator in class SXCMINT
    • withValue

      public IVLINT withValue(BigInteger value)
      Overrides:
      withValue in class SXCMINT
    • withNullFlavor

      public IVLINT withNullFlavor(String... values)
      Overrides:
      withNullFlavor in class SXCMINT
    • withNullFlavor

      public IVLINT withNullFlavor(Collection<String> values)
      Overrides:
      withNullFlavor in class SXCMINT
    • equals

      public boolean equals(Object object)
      Overrides:
      equals in class SXCMINT
    • hashCode

      public int hashCode()
      Overrides:
      hashCode in class SXCMINT
    • toString

      public String toString()
      Generates a String representation of the contents of this type. This is an extension method, produced by the 'ts' xjc plugin
      Overrides:
      toString in class SXCMINT